Conclusion
Shimano Stradic FM 1000FMX clearly outshines Mitchell 308 PRO 2000X, offering significantly better performance in ball bearings (6+1) and durability (8.5 out of 10). While Mitchell 308 PRO 2000X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ano Stradic FM 1000FMX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
